文档
注册

虚拟机安装NPU驱动

登录虚拟机

在物理机上通过ssh root@xxx命令登录目标虚拟机(xxx为目标虚拟机IP地址,如:192.168.1.199)。

查看操作系统内核版本

执行uname -r命令查看虚拟机操作系统内核版本。

表1 内核版本要求

host操作系统版本

软件包默认的host操作系统内核版本

安装方式

Ubuntu 20.04

5.4.0-26-generic

二进制安装。

直接按照安装NPU驱动内容安装驱动固件。

CentOS 8.2

4.18.0-193.el8.aarch64

源码编译安装。

  1. 需要先参见安装驱动源码编译所需依赖安装dkms等依赖。
  2. 再按照安装NPU驱动内容安装驱动固件。

openEuler 20.03 LTS

4.19.90-2003.4.0.0036.oe1.aarch64

Kylin V10 SP2

4.19.90-24.4.v2101.ky10.aarch64

安装NPU驱动

  1. 创建驱动运行用户HwHiAiUser(运行驱动进程的用户),安装驱动时无需指定运行用户,默认即为HwHiAiUser。
    groupadd HwHiAiUser
    useradd -g HwHiAiUser -d /home/HwHiAiUser -m HwHiAiUser -s /bin/bash
  2. 将驱动包上传到虚拟机任意目录如“/home”
  3. 进入驱动包所在目录,执行如下命令,增加驱动包的可执行权限。
    chmod +x Ascend-hdk-310p-npu-driver_24.1.rc1_linux-aarch64.run
  4. 执行以下命令,完成驱动安装,软件包默认安装路径为“/usr/local/Ascend”
    ./Ascend-hdk-310p-npu-driver_24.1.rc1_linux-aarch64.run --full  --install-for-all

    若执行上述安装命令出现类似如下回显信息,请参见驱动安装缺少依赖报错解决。

    [ERROR]The list of missing tools: lspci,ifconfig,
    若系统出现如下关键回显信息,则表示驱动安装成功。
    Driver package installed successfully!
  5. 执行npu-smi info查看驱动加载是否成功。

    若出现类似如下图所示回显信息,说明加载成功。否则,说明加载失败。请联系华为技术支持处理。

搜索结果
找到“0”个结果

当前产品无相关内容

未找到相关内容,请尝试其他搜索词